Major Selling Points |
Justice Hunters introduces three new themes to the TCG. Dracotails: a Fusion-heavy theme made up of Dragons and Spellcasters, based on the Western zodiac. K9: an Xyz-heavy theme that summons Rank 5 Xyz Monsters, based on police dogs. Yummy: a Synchro-heavy theme made of low-Level Beast monsters, themed around puns involving desserts, black cats, and aliens. |
Set Breakdown
Justice Hunters contains 60 cards:
- 10 Ultra Rares
- 10 Super Rares
- 40 Rares
In addition,
- 18 Rares are also available as Super Rare upgrades.
- 15 cards are also available as Collector’s Rares.
- 10 cards are also available as Starlight Rares.
